Vital Mechanical Inspections

Prioritize your car’s most important systems by reviewing essential components first. Have a technician examine your coolant, brake, and transmission fluids to ensure they are at optimal levels and free of contaminants. Since winter weather is notoriously hard on battery life, a professional performance test is essential to prevent a breakdown. Additionally, an underbody inspection is crucial to spot any salt-related corrosion on the suspension or fuel lines before it spreads.

Visibility and Cabin Comfort

Enhancing safety begins with a clear view of the road and a well-maintained interior. Swap out worn wiper blades that may have been damaged by ice and check that every bulb in your lighting system is functioning properly. If your headlights look foggy or oxidized, a restoration treatment can significantly improve nighttime visibility. Inside the cabin, applying a high-quality conditioner to leather upholstery will shield it from UV damage as the spring sun strengthens.

Tire Performance and Exterior Care

The transition into spring is the ideal moment to assess how your vehicle connects with the pavement. Whether you are switching back from winter tires or simply rotating your current set, always confirm your tire pressure and tread depth meet safety standards. Afterward, treat the body of the car to a thorough wash and wax to remove lingering winter grime. Addressing small paint chips now will seal the metal and prevent moisture from causing rust.

Early Air Conditioning Service

Avoid the discomfort of a failing cooling system during the first heatwave of the year. A pre-season AC diagnostic can identify small leaks or mechanical issues early, saving you from more costly repairs down the line.
